Why Study Environmental Science?

As human populations have grown rapidly, the increasing demand for natural resources and continued alteration of Earth's systems have produced a wide array unintended consequences. In recent years, environmental concerns increasinlgy have come to the forefront within the larger context of economics, politics, and international policy. Whatever your chosen career path, you undoubtedly will encounter these environmental issues in the media; perhaps they will even affect you personally. As global citizens, it is critical that we understand the physical, chemical, and biological processes that shape the Earth and the social and political processes that influence our responses to environmental change. Studying Environmental Science will give you a solid understanding of the dynamic relationship between humans and the natural world so that you will be able to make informed decisions on environmental issues.
